In order to access ‘Zoom’ you will need:

  • A computer, laptop or iPad/tablet connected to the internet. Although you can access ‘Zoom’ on your mobile phone this is not ideal.

  • Ensure your child has a quiet, comfortable space to work in and is sat at a table.

  • It would be useful for your child to have an exercise book or paper, pencils, rubbers, pens, marker pens and a printer. If you have a mini whiteboard and white board marker this may also be useful.

  • Please notify your teacher if you do not have any of this equipment, particularly a printer as you may be required to print out some resources.

  • You may be asked to provide some additional equipment based on the lesson plan. Your teacher will communicate this with you before the session to give you time to prepare.

  • Depending on the age of the student, parent participation may be required during the session – particularly to support with technology if required.
